Fruit-Based Desserts

One classic option for pairing desserts with fish is to incorporate fruit. Fruits, such as berries or tropical delights like mangoes and pineapples, can bring a refreshing and palate-cleansing element to your meal. The natural sweetness of the fruit can complement the savory flavors of the fish, creating a perfect balance of tastes.

For a delightful combination of flavors, consider serving a fruit tart with a flaky crust and a dollop of freshly whipped cream alongside grilled fish. The buttery crust provides a satisfying crunch, while the creamy whipped cream adds a touch of indulgence. The vibrant colors and flavors of the fresh fruit will not only enhance the presentation of the dish but also add a burst of natural sweetness.

Light and Refreshing Sorbets

Another fantastic option for fish-friendly desserts is sorbets. These frozen treats are light, refreshing, and come in a variety of flavors. Perfect for cleansing the palate between bites of fish, sorbets can add a burst of fruity goodness to your dining experience.

Try a lemon or grapefruit sorbet to awaken your taste buds and enhance the flavors of delicate white fish. The tangy and citrusy notes of the sorbet will provide a refreshing contrast to the mild flavors of the fish. The cool and smooth texture of the sorbet will also provide a pleasant sensation, especially during warm summer months.

Creamy and Rich Puddings

For those who prefer a creamy and indulgent dessert, puddings are an excellent choice to pair with fish. Consider serving a velvety chocolate or vanilla pudding alongside a heartier fish dish, such as grilled salmon. The smooth texture and rich flavors of the pudding will provide a delightful contrast to the savory fish.

To elevate the experience, you can garnish the pudding with a sprinkle of cocoa powder or a drizzle of caramel sauce. The combination of the creamy pudding and the caramelized flavors will create a decadent treat that complements the robust flavors of the fish. The richness of the pudding will leave you feeling satisfied and content.

Asian Dessert and Fish Combinations

Asian cuisine is renowned for its bold and diverse flavors. When it comes to desserts and fish, Asian culinary traditions offer a plethora of intriguing combinations. Flavors like ginger, sesame, and lychee are commonly used in Asian desserts, and when paired with fish dishes, they create a symphony of taste sensations. Imagine a ginger-infused coconut rice pudding served alongside a flaky fish fillet – the creamy sweetness of the pudding perfectly complementing the delicate flavors of the fish. It’s a match made in culinary heaven.

Moreover, Asian desserts often incorporate unique ingredients like matcha, red bean, or pandan, which add depth and complexity to the overall flavor profile. These desserts can provide a delightful contrast to the savory notes of fish, elevating the dining experience to new heights.

Mediterranean Sweet Treats to Follow Seafood

The Mediterranean region is a treasure trove of culinary delights, known for its fresh seafood and delectable desserts. It’s no wonder that Mediterranean cuisine offers some of the most enticing pairings of fish and sweet treats. Traditional desserts like baklava, with its layers of flaky pastry and honey-soaked nuts, provide a perfect balance of sweetness and texture. When enjoyed after a seafood feast, the nutty flavors and fragrant aromas of baklava create a harmonious symphony with the flavors of the fish, leaving a lasting impression on the palate.

Other Mediterranean desserts, such as honey-soaked pastries or citrus-infused cakes, also make excellent companions to seafood. The natural sweetness of these treats enhances the natural flavors of the fish, creating a delightful interplay of tastes that will transport you to the shores of the Mediterranean.

Traditional North American Pairings

In North America, certain dessert pairings have become iconic when it comes to serving fish. One such classic combination is fish with key lime pie. The tangy and creamy filling of key lime pie is often associated with seafood cuisine, particularly in coastal regions. The zesty lime flavors provide a refreshing contrast to the richness of fish, creating a perfect balance of flavors. To take it to the next level, a dollop of freshly whipped cream on top adds a touch of indulgence, making every bite a true delight.

North American cuisine also offers other intriguing dessert options to pair with fish. For example, a warm apple crisp with a hint of cinnamon can provide a comforting and familiar note to accompany a savory fish dish. The combination of the sweet, caramelized apples with the savory fish creates a delightful contrast that satisfies both the sweet tooth and the craving for a satisfying main course.

Dietary Considerations for Dessert Selection

Gluten-Free Dessert Options

For those with gluten sensitivities or dietary restrictions, there are plenty of delicious gluten-free dessert options to enjoy with fish. Consider desserts made with almond flour or coconut flour, such as flourless chocolate cake or coconut macaroons. These treats can add a delightful touch of sweetness without compromising dietary needs.

Dairy-Free and Vegan Desserts

If you follow a dairy-free or vegan lifestyle, fear not. There are fantastic desserts available that will enhance your fish dining experience. Look for vegan versions of classics like cheesecake or ice cream, made with plant-based ingredients like cashews or coconut milk. These desserts provide the creaminess and flavor you desire, without any animal-derived ingredients.

Low-Sugar and Diabetic-Friendly Choices

For those who need to watch their sugar intake, there are plenty of low-sugar and diabetic-friendly desserts to enjoy with fish. Opt for desserts sweetened with natural alternatives like stevia or small amounts of honey or maple syrup. Fresh fruit salads or sugar-free gelatins can also provide a light and satisfying ending to your seafood meal.
